About the Opportunity
W.C. Spratt, Inc. is seeking an experienced Pipe Crew Laborer to work on local underground utility construction projects within 50 miles of Fredericksburg, VA. This full‑time position offers competitive hourly pay of $30.00 – $35.00, benefits, and the chance to join a respected, employee‑owned company (ESOP) where your skills in water, sewer, and storm pipe installation are valued.
Key Responsibilities- Lay various types of pipe for water lines, sanitary sewers, storm sewers, and drains.
- Align and position pipes to prepare for welding, sealing, or joining.
- Check slopes for conformance to specifications and engineered plans.
- Cut, thread, hammer, and weld pipe using saws, pipe threaders, benders, or other tools.
- Inspect, examine, and test installed systems and pipelines using pressure hydrostatic testing, observation, or other methods.
- Measure and mark pipes for cutting and threading.
- Plan pipe installation or repair according to project specifications.
- Set up pipe lasers and grade ditches accurately.
- Maintain safe and organized job sites following W.C. Spratt’s quality and safety standards.

Founded in 1927, W.C. Spratt, Inc. is a leader in sitework construction and design‑build underground utility projects in the Fredericksburg, VA region. As an employee‑owned company, Spratt specializes in water distribution systems, sanitary sewer systems, storm sewer networks, and trenchless technologies including horizontal directional drilling. Every team member contributes to the company’s success and shares in its growth.
